2. Dolph Ziggler
Ziggler is one of the most underutilized talents on the current roster. The guy has been around for more than a ten years in the WWE and still has been confined to the realms of the mid-card.
Ziggler has become a sentinel of sorts, of the main roster. Any promising superstar who has to cross over from NXT to the main roster has to go through Ziggler these days.
Currently feuding with Baron Corbin, Dolph has helped rookies like Tyler Breeze and Big-E make a name for themselves at his expense. Not only in the ring, but Ziggler puts over people in promos as well. Moreover, his best trait is his wrestling style that gels well with any wrestler you pit him against, resulting in some solid matches.
Had it not been for Ziggler on the current roster, getting over would have been a laborious task for the NXT graduates taking their initial steps in the WWE.
